Who is leading the coefficient table?
As of 26 January, England is leading the coefficient table. Premier League clubs have built up the most points and have the highest average.
1. England - points: 100; average: 14.34
2. Italy - points: 88; average: 11.05
3. Spain - points: 82; average: 11.77
4. France - points: 66 average: 10.94
5. Germany - points: 79 - average: 9.88
According to Opta, there is a 98% chance that the Premier League will earn an additional place in next season's Champions League.
